少儿编程 用什么语言
-
少儿编程可以使用多种编程语言进行学习和实践。以下是一些常用的少儿编程语言:
-
Scratch:Scratch是由麻省理工学院开发的图形化编程语言,适用于初学者。通过拖拽积木形成代码块来编写程序,使编程变得简单易懂,并能够实现一些基本的动画和游戏制作。
-
Python:Python是一种易于学习的通用编程语言,适合初学者。它的语法简单明了,易于理解,并且有大量的学习资源和社区支持。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,也可以用于编写简单的游戏和动画。它是一种强大的语言,对于有一定编程基础的孩子来说是一个很好的选择。
-
Blockly:Blockly是一种基于图块的编程语言,它提供了一种可视化的编程环境,使编程更加直观和有趣。它可以与其他编程语言(如Python和JavaScript)结合使用,适合初学者。
-
Swift:Swift是苹果公司开发的一种用于iOS应用程序开发的编程语言。对于对移动应用有兴趣的孩子来说,学习Swift可以帮助他们进入移动开发的世界。
选择适合的编程语言取决于孩子的年龄、编程经验和兴趣。以上列举的语言都有丰富的学习资源和社区支持,可以根据具体情况选择合适的语言进行学习。无论选择哪种语言,关键是培养孩子的逻辑思维和解决问题的能力。
1年前 -
-
少儿编程可以使用多种编程语言进行学习和实践。以下是一些适合少儿编程的语言:
-
Scratch:Scratch是由麻省理工学院开发的一个基于图形化编程的教育平台。它通过拖拽和连接图形化积木块来编写程序,适合儿童入门学习编程。Scratch可视化界面简洁友好,提供了动画、游戏和交互等方面的编程功能,帮助儿童培养逻辑思维和创意能力。
-
Python:Python是一种简单易学的编程语言,被广泛应用于各个领域。对于少儿编程而言,Python的语法简洁明了,适合初学者掌握。同时,Python也具有强大的库和工具支持,可以用于开发简单的游戏、动画、机器人等项目,帮助孩子培养问题解决能力和编程思维。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,也是当前最流行的编程语言之一。除了用于网页开发,JavaScript还可以通过各种工具和库进行游戏开发和动画制作。少儿可以通过学习JavaScript编程,了解Web技术和交互设计的基础知识,培养创造性和逻辑思维。
-
Logo:Logo是一种针对教育目的而设计的编程语言,其特点是简单易学和可视化。Logo通过控制一个名为"海龟"的图形来进行编程,海龟会按照编写的指令绘制图形。Logo可以帮助儿童学习控制流程、图形绘制和问题求解,是一个培养创造力和逻辑思维的理想工具。
-
Blockly:Blockly是一个图形化编程工具,可以用于多种编程语言,如Scratch、Python、JavaScript等。它提供了类似积木块的界面,让孩子们通过拖拽和连接积木块来编写代码。Blockly结合了可视化和文本化的编程方式,可以帮助儿童从图形化编程逐渐过渡到文本化编程。
这些编程语言和工具都受到了广泛的教育界和编程教育机构的认可和使用。选择哪种编程语言取决于儿童的年龄、兴趣和学习目标,让他们能够在学习编程的过程中获得乐趣和成就感是非常重要的。
1年前 -
-
少儿编程是一种为儿童设计的编程教育方式,旨在培养孩子的逻辑思维能力、创造力和解决问题的能力。在选择编程语言时,需要考虑以下几个因素:
-
可视化编程语言:对于初学者来说,可视化编程语言是一种更友好的选择。这种编程语言使用图形化的方式来表示编程逻辑,使得编程变得直观易懂。常见的可视化编程语言有Scratch和Blockly。
-
文本编程语言:一些年长的孩子或有一定编程基础的孩子可能更适合学习文本编程语言。这种编程语言使用文字来表示编程逻辑,更接近专业的编程语言。常见的文本编程语言有Python、Java和C++。
根据孩子的年龄和程度,可以选择合适的编程语言。下面介绍几种适合少儿编程的编程语言:
-
Scratch:这是由麻省理工学院开发的可视化编程语言,适合5岁以上的孩子学习。它的界面友好,使用积木图块来表示编程逻辑,孩子只需拖拽图块进行编程,而不需要输入代码。Scratch适合编写简单的动画、游戏和交互式故事。
-
Blockly:这是谷歌开发的可视化编程语言,适合7岁以上的孩子学习。与Scratch类似,Blockly也使用积木图块来表示编程逻辑,但它更加灵活,可以用于编写更复杂的程序。Blockly可以与许多编程环境集成,如Scratch、App Inventor等。
-
Python:这是一种流行的文本编程语言,适合高年级的孩子学习。Python语法简洁易懂,可以用于编写各种类型的程序,如游戏、网站和机器学习。Python拥有丰富的学习资源和社区支持,孩子可以通过在线教程、编程游戏和编程竞赛来学习和提升自己的编程能力。
除了上述几种编程语言,还有一些其他的编程工具和平台也适合少儿编程学习,如Micro:bit、Arduino、MIT App Inventor等。无论选择哪种编程语言,重要的是给孩子提供一个自由实践、探索和创造的环境,鼓励他们动手编程,培养他们的创造力和解决问题的能力。
1年前 -